/Sounds like "fah" (as in "far") + "yoo" (as in "you") + "KEH" (as in "kept") + "roh" (as in "row")/

Meaning

In Mexico, someone who sells imported or smuggled goods, typically electronics, clothes, or perfumes, at prices well below retail. From "fayuca," meaning informally imported merchandise.

Examples

I bought headphones from the fayuquero at the market, half the price of the store.

That fayuquero already has the latest models before they officially arrive.
